隨著互聯網的快速發展,數據的重要性也越來越凸顯出來。MySQL作為一種常用的數據庫管理系統,其容災措施的重要性也不言而喻。本文將介紹MySQL容災的一些重要措施及實施方法,以期能夠幫助大家更好地保護自己的數據。
備份是MySQL容災的基礎。在數據出現問題時,備份可以幫助我們快速恢復數據。MySQL的備份有兩種方式:物理備份和邏輯備份。物理備份是指將數據存儲在磁盤上,而邏輯備份是指將數據以SQL語句的形式進行備份。在進行備份時,我們需要注意備份的頻率和備份的存儲位置,以確保備份的完整性和安全性。
2.主從復制
主從復制是一種常用的MySQL容災方案。主從復制是指將主數據庫的數據同步到從數據庫中,以實現數據的備份和容災。在主從復制中,主數據庫負責寫入數據,而從數據庫則負責讀取數據。在進行主從復制時,我們需要注意主從復制的延遲和主從復制的一致性,以確保數據的完整性和準確性。
集群是一種高可用的MySQL容災方案。集群是指將多個數據庫連接在一起,形成一個整體,以實現數據的備份和容災。在集群中,每個節點都可以讀寫數據,當其中一個節點出現故障時,其他節點可以接管故障節點的工作。在進行集群配置時,我們需要注意集群的網絡拓撲和集群的數據同步,以確保數據的高可用性和可靠性。
監控是MySQL容災的重要手段。監控可以幫助我們及時發現數據出現問題的情況,以便我們及時采取措施。在進行監控時,我們需要注意監控的頻率和監控的指標,以確保監控的準確性和及時性。
MySQL容災是保護數據安全的重要措施。備份、主從復制、集群和監控是MySQL容災的常用手段。在進行MySQL容災時,我們需要注意數據的完整性和安全性,以確保數據的高可用性和可靠性。